The Altar of Desire: A Song of Passion

Thy breath upon my throat, a sacred fire,
Awakes the trembling chords of deep desire;
Thy hand, a wandering warmth of gentle might,
Unveils the velvet secrets of the night.

Within this shadowed room where time takes flight,
Our pulsing hearts surrender to the height
Of fevered dreams, where senses intertwine,
And mortal flesh tastes nectar most divine.

‘Tis alchemy that bids the soul expand,
To drink the flames that flicker in thy hand;
In this abyss where reason fades away,
We merge as shadows at the break of day.

O spiritual bond through carnal grace defined!
In rhythmic sighs our spirits are aligned;
We touch the infinite, beyond all measure,
Consumed within the beauty of our pleasure.

This piece mirrors the Victorian fascination with the sublime—the moment where human emotion becomes so intense it transcends the physical plane. It speaks to the paradoxical nature of passion: a grounding physical act that simultaneously elevates the spirit to ethereal heights.
